Before acquiring an industrial company such as one in energy, transportation, or manufacturing, private equity firms should evaluate cybersecurity to prevent value erosion after the deal. Asking targeted questions helps determine a company’s cybersecurity maturity and risk exposure. One key consideration is whether the organization has selected a recognized cybersecurity framework or standard to manage cyber risk, as this indicates a baseline level of structured controls. Understanding how cybersecurity fits into overall risk management provides insight into governance, preparedness, and resilience. These questions help investors identify gaps, anticipate remediation costs, and make informed decisions about protecting and enhancing the value of a new portfolio company.
